Fantastic Four #548
Part of Marvel's 2007 "The Initiative" banner, this issue showcases a bold new era for the Fantastic Four with a striking cover by penciler Michael Turner and inker Mark Roslan. The team's lineup looks refreshingly different here — Sue Storm floats ready for action alongside a blazing Human Torch, the ever-rocky Thing anchors the foreground, while two unfamiliar faces take prominent spots: a sharp-featured man in a blue FF uniform and a white-haired woman in black with dramatic wings spread behind her. Writer Dwayne McDuffie and artist Paul Pelletier continue their "Reconstruction" arc, and if this cover is any indication, the team dynamic has some genuinely intriguing new energy running through it.
